Ingredients
- - tri color pasta
- - hard salami, sliced
- - black olives, sliced
- - feta cheese crumbles
- - greek vinegrette dressing
How To Make greek pasta salad
-
Step 1How much you use of each ingredient depends on how much you need and your own indiviual tastes.
-
Step 2Cook pasta according to package directions, drain and rinse with cold water to cool. Slice salami slices into quarters. Mix all ingredients in a large bowl. Cover and refrigerate, overnight is best.
-
Step 3Before serving add additional dressing since it always seems to be absorbed by the pasta. This recipe is easy to customize to your families taste, you can add peppers, beets, or use pepperoni instead of salami.
